Verserc tablets are a medication used to treat vertigo and dizziness associated with Meniere's disease, an inner ear disorder that affects balance and hearing. Verserc works by improving blood flow in the inner ear and reducing fluid buildup, which relieves the symptoms of vertigo and dizziness, reduces the frequency and severity of vertigo and dizziness attacks, and improves the quality of life for patients with Meniere's disease.
Active Ingredients in Verserc Tablets
Verserc tablets contain one active ingredient:
Betahistine: This medication works by improving blood flow in the inner ear and reducing fluid buildup, which helps relieve the symptoms of vertigo and dizziness.
Available Strengths
Verserc tablets are available in different strengths, such as 8 mg and 16 mg, to suit different patient needs.

Drug Interactions for Verserc Tablets
The patient should inform their doctor about all medications they are taking, including prescription and nonprescription medications and nutritional supplements, as some medications may interact with Verserc.
Verserc may interact with some antihistamine medications, reducing the effectiveness of both medications.
